MISSION STATEMENT<br />

Saint Margaret Mary's College is a community of faith striving to live the message of Christ.<br />

Faith Education will be seen as our primary goal. This will be nurtured not only in the curriculum but also in the<br />

caring atmosphere of staff, parents and fellow students.<br />

The College will aim to meet the needs of the whole person. It will provide a high standard of education that will<br />

challenge students to achieve their inborn potential:<br />

spiritually;<br />

academically;<br />

physically;<br />

socially.<br />

It is recognised that each student’s contribution will be unique.<br />

To achieve these goals there will need to be a close working harmony between Church, home, the community<br />

and the College.<br />

ENROLMENT POLICY<br />

Saint Margaret Mary's College, as part of the Ministry of the Catholic Church, has a specific and distinctive<br />

purpose to create a community of faith and learning. As a Catholic College, the Christian spirit and values will<br />

permeate all areas of learning and College life, determining the whole atmosphere of the College.<br />

Saint Margaret Mary's, by reflecting its Catholic identity, assists in the full personal and academic development<br />

of those in its care. This College, as a community of faith, supports the family by nurturing children in the<br />

Catholic faith.<br />

Enrolment priority will be given to children of parents who are actively involved in the life of the Christian<br />

Church.<br />

Saint Margaret Mary's is a faith community. It is expected that children who are enrolled should have a<br />

background of religious beliefs and practices which, with their family, will enable them to contribute actively,<br />

participate in and benefit from involvement in the College.<br />

Cases of special need (spiritual, material, emotional, physical, pastoral) may arise which may necessitate<br />

individual attention.<br />
